Here we have a nice small antique oak and mahogany cross banded 30 hour longcase / grandfather clock with beautiful shell inlaid in the trunk door and in the base. There are also some very nice inlays above and below the trunk door and above the hood door. It is the original dial to movement and to the case.
The dial has lovely gilded and painted corners and a pretty bird to the centre and is signed 'Jas Shipley, Derby' who is recorded in 'Brain Loomes Watchmakers & Clocksmakers of the World Volume 2' as 'SHIPLEY. James. Derby(B 1890). 1828-35. Watchmaker'.
